Transaction 8f578b2f7978bf8d1da8a741693793bcaebb556061d77cbe21716aafcfc155f3

1 Input
2 Outputs
  • 8f578b2f7978bf8d1da8a741693793bcaebb556061d77cbe21716aafcfc155f3:0
  • value  300000000
    address  1MmMAqhurDsHjkXUhCQzjJmjBF1kFMdrZE
  • 8f578b2f7978bf8d1da8a741693793bcaebb556061d77cbe21716aafcfc155f3:1
  • value  149984607
    address  19AtrEvJv7UY75tvWkXMxLUAYibxpZhFfN